Ruben Dias has agreed a new four-year deal with Manchester City to secure his long-term future with the club. The new contract includes the option of an extra year that, if fulfilled, would see him complete a decade with the Blues.

Dias signed for City in 2020 and instantly transformed a defence that had been too shaky in the year since Vincent Kompany had left the club and surrendered their Premier League title to Liverpool. The Portugal international played an integral part in the team that not only won four leagues in a row but also completed the Treble in 2023.

Despite injury struggles last year that saw him impact limited, Dias has still been seen as an important part of the club's future and contract talks have been successful this summer to tie down a player whose deal had been expiring in 2027.

"I am incredibly happy today. I’m so proud to represent this great club," the 28-year-old said. "City are where I want to be – at the top of the sport, competing for trophies. The club’s ambition aligns perfectly with mine and as a footballer there is nothing better than that.

"I love Manchester – it is my home now – and I love the Manchester City fans. Their support from day one has been absolutely unbelievable, and I appreciate them a lot. When I think about the trophies we have won and the way we have played our football during my time here, I couldn’t imagine playing anywhere else.

"My job now is to be the best I can be for the duration of this contract, so that I can play my part in helping us challenge for more silverware.

"I want to thank my teammates, Pep [Guardiola, Hugo [Viana, sporting director], the coaching staff and everyone at the club. This is such a special place, and I am grateful every single day for the support I receive. Now the hard work begins, and I want to promise the fans that I will give everything to win more trophies and bring more success to City."

Viana's work continues in what is expected to be a busy final few weeks of the transfer window for City. The futures of Ederson, Savinho, and Manu Akanji have to be resolved along with any potential replacements for those exits while Rico Lewis is also expected to sign a new deal to commit his future to the club after an uncertain summer.

As he continues that business, the sporting director is happy to have had a happy resolution to talks with an 'ultimate professional' at the club.

“As a club, we're really excited that Rúben has signed a new contract and committed his long-term future to the club. His hard work, professionalism and sheer dedication are clear to all of us every single day," he said.

"He is a leader in the dressing room and on the pitch. He is one of our captains, the players listen to him and Pep and the coaching staff love working with him. He is the ultimate professional.

“His performances over the past five years have been outstanding and he is a big reason why we have been so successful. Every time Rúben pulls on a City shirt, he gives his all for the badge and we are so happy to know he will be here for the next four years.”
